How to Pronounce Abdicant?

Correct pronunciation for the word "Abdicant" is [ˈabdɪkənt], [ˈabdɪkənt], [ˈa_b_d_ɪ_k_ə_n_t].

Definition of Abdicant

  1. The person abdicating.
  2. Abdicating; renouncing.

Nuttall's Standard dictionary of the English language By Nuttall, P.Austin
